Responding to a new inquiry within five minutes made contact 100 times more likely than waiting thirty minutes, and made the lead 21 times more likely to enter the sales process at all.
MIT Sloan / Lead Response Management study, 2007Dr. James Oldroyd; 15,000+ leads and 100,000+ call attempts across six companiesBusinesses that got back to a new inquiry within an hour were nearly seven times more likely to qualify that lead than businesses that responded even an hour after that — and more than sixty times more likely than the ones who waited a day.
Harvard Business Review, 2011Audit of 2,241 U.S. companies' response timesMore than half of mobile visits are abandoned if a page takes longer than three seconds to load — the visitor is back in search results before they ever see who you are.
Google, 2017Google/SOASTA analysis of mobile page-speed benchmarks68% of consumers say they'll only use a business rated four stars or higher — up from 55% a year earlier. Nearly a third now hold out for 4.5+.

Frequently asked questions
Will the AI agent actually understand where a caller is stranded?+
The agent is built to collect location details — cross streets, highway mile markers, parking lots — and log them clearly so you have what you need before you dispatch.
What happens when a job needs a human right away?+
You can set rules for how urgent calls are handled — the agent can alert you by text or call you directly so time-sensitive situations get your attention quickly.
Do my customers know they're talking to an AI?+
The agent answers your business line in your business name. You decide how it introduces itself. Most owners prefer a friendly, professional tone that gets straight to the caller's location and needs.
